It's the start of another busy week for our Parisians. Luis Enrique's men face Stade Briochin (N2) on Wednesday 26th February at Roazhon Park in Rennes, with the aim of booking their place in the last four of the Coupe de France. Les Rouge et Bleu then return to Ligue 1 action and the Parc des Princes on Saturday 1st March for the 24th round of matches against Lille, kick-off at 9.05pm.

the women's team:
It's time for the Parisians to return to action after a week's international break. Fabrice Abriel and his players, 3rd in the Première Ligue with 35 points, will be back in action when they travel to Dijon FCO, 4th with six points less, on Saturday 1st March at 1.30pm at the Stade Gaston Gérard for the 16th round of matches in the Arkema Première Ligue.
youth teams:
Paris Saint-Germain's U19 team have no fixtures this week, and will have to wait until Sunday 9th March to get back into action when they welcome RC Lens to the Campus PSG (3pm), as part of the 20th Matchday in the U19 Championnat National.
The same goes the U17s, who make their return to the pitch on Sunday 9th March, when they travel to Le Havre for the 20th round of the U17 Championnat National (3pm).
This weekend, all eyes will be on the capital club's U19 women's team, who host Olympique de Marseille on Sunday 2nd March for matchday 4 of the phase élite of their league. The girls are currently top of their group with 9 points from 3 matches. The match is scheduled for 3pm at the Campus PSG, and will be live on PSG TV Premium!
HANDBALL:
Following last weekend's 37-34 victory over Pays d'Aix, the club from the capital will be back at the Stade Pierre de Coubertin on Thursday 27th February for an EHF Champions League clash against group leaders Veszprém. This is the final home match of the group phase, and it could prove crucial if the club is to qualify directly for the quarter-finals of the competition!
